    Also, I've noticed that doing this with MS Paint is a pain. And image 9000,11 is reserved for the KOF XI lifebars by Vans.

  • I know it is a pain in MS Paint. That is why I made a photoshop tutorial. Cleaning, resizing, using layers makes your life easier.

    About the image 9000,11. That is why I showed both version. The old lifebears used 9000,11 but the new ones use 9000,19 to avoid that conflict which you mentioned.
